Description
I love Brené Brown’s story. A “late bloomer,” Brené graduated from her undergrad when she was 29 years old, then proceeded straight into her master’s and Ph.D. programs. She experienced first-hand the impact of amazing professors and knew what she wanted her life’s work to be—changing the lives of students while getting to talk about what she was passionate about. And Brené is passionate about vulnerability. She shared her passion in a TedxHouston talk, “The Power of Vulnerability,” and to her great surprise it went viral. To date, it has been viewed over 35 million times online and is one of the top 5 TED talks of all time. Join us as we discuss what brings Brené joy; who inspired her to pay attention to vulnerability; and how the stories we tell ourselves can make or break us.
